Why Gold Prices Are Rising and What It Means for ASX Gold Stocks

Several macroeconomic factors have driven gold prices upward recently:

  • Inflation Concerns: Rising inflation globally has led investors to seek gold as a store of value to protect against currency devaluation.

  • Geopolitical Uncertainty: Ongoing geopolitical tensions increase demand for gold as a “safe haven” investment.

  • Central Bank Policies: Low interest rates and expansive monetary policies make non-yielding gold more attractive.

  • US Dollar Weakness: Since gold is priced in US dollars, a weaker dollar tends to push gold prices higher.

As gold prices increase, ASX gold stocks often benefit through improved profitability and higher cash flows, making them attractive for investors looking to capitalize on the precious metals rally.

Key Drivers Behind ASX Gold Stock Performance

Several factors influence the performance of ASX gold stocks:

  • Exploration Success: Discovering new gold deposits can significantly increase a company's value and future production potential.

  • Production Efficiency: Companies with lower all-in sustaining costs (AISC) are better positioned to maintain profitability even if gold prices fluctuate.

  • Resource Expansion: Increasing proven and probable reserves supports long-term growth and investor confidence.

  • Strategic Acquisitions: Mergers and acquisitions can provide access to new projects and technologies, enhancing company value.

  • Sustainability Practices: 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) initiatives are increasingly valued by investors and can improve access to capital.

Risks to Consider When Investing in ASX Gold Stocks

Despite the positive outlook, investing in gold stocks carries risks:

  • Gold Price Volatility: Gold prices can be volatile and influenced by factors such as currency fluctuations, interest rate changes, and geopolitical events.

  • Operational Risks: Mining companies face risks including equipment failure, labor disputes, and environmental challenges.

  • Regulatory Risks: Australian mining operations are subject to environmental regulations and community relations that can impact project timelines.

  • Exploration Uncertainty: Not all exploration efforts yield economically viable deposits, and drilling results can be unpredictable.
